Operations Manager/Executive Director Trainee

Spokane Indian Housing Authority (SIHA) provides a variety of housing related services to eligible applicants within our service area. SIHA’s mission is to empower all Spokane Tribal members by creating housing and housing opportunities to have a safe, suitable, and affordable home within the SIHA service area.

Primary Responsibilities
  • Oversee the coordination and execution of daily operational activities across the organization.
  • Conduct routine meetings with each department to enhance interactions with management and to cultivate an open forum for new ideas.
  • Lead, train and develop staff to foster a high-performance culture and ensure operational excellence.
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for operational needs and functions.
  • Work with each department to develop and maintain standard operating procedures (SOPs) for all core operational tasks.
  • Evaluate existing workflows, identify inefficiencies, and implement improvements.
  • Keep SIHA up-to-date on related program rules and policies; maintain knowledge of changes and suggest updates as needed.
  • Act as a liaison between departments to facilitate communication and workflow.
  • Coordinate meetings, training, and company events.
  • Prepare and deliver operational reports and recommendations to the Board of Commissioners.
  • Support operational budget planning and monitor expenses to ensure fiscal responsibility.
  • Review and process invoices, ensuring accuracy and compliance with policies.
  • Identify cost-saving opportunities without compromising quality of service.
  • Lead liaison with the Board of Commissioners, Tribe, and outside organizations.
  • Direct, monitor, and evaluate the procurement and contract process to ensure contract compliance and quality control.
  • Assure effective and efficient implementation of grant monies and program compliance with policies and regulations imposed by funding sources.
  • Assist in the creation of and enforcement of SIHA Policies and Procedures.
  • Prepare and present administrative, statistical, and fiscal reports.
  • Direct the preparation of the Indian Housing Plans and Annual Performance Reviews for submission to HUD.
  • Secure additional funding and grant money for continuation and expansion of program services.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
Experience and Skill Requirements
  • Minimum Education and Experience — Bachelor’s degree in business administration, public works, or related field;
    Three to Five years progressive experience in a related field; 5 years in a supervisory position;
    An equivalent level of education and experience that demonstrates the applicant’s ability to meet the needs of the position may be considered.
  • Must be capable of passing a background check and drug screening.
  • Must have a valid Washington State Driver’s License and be insurable.
  • Knowledge — Knowledge of traditional forms of government and tribal customs and traditions; applicable federal, state, county and local laws, regulations, and requirements; department organization, functions, objectives, policies, and procedures; management principles and supervisory techniques; the general principles of grant writing; budget preparation; procurement procedures; sensitivity to tribal customs and beliefs.
  • Skills — Excellent communication skills; strong organizational skills; critical thinking; mathematical skills; ability to prepare, review, and analyze operational and financial reports; ability to supervise, train, and evaluate assigned staff.
  • Abilities — Build and maintain professional relationships; read and interpret reports; work independently and in a team; listen and take direction; thrive in fast-paced environments; maintain a positive attitude under stress; interpret laws; operate MIP Accounting software and office software; meet strict timelines; communicate effectively; analyze situations and take appropriate action; make solid decisions; maintain confidentiality.
